在STAR-CCM+中,如何生成高质量的CFD网格并设置正确的边界条件以进行有效的流体动力学模拟?
时间: 2024-10-31 12:13:41 浏览: 79
在使用STAR-CCM+进行计算流体动力学(CFD)模拟时,创建高质量的计算网格和设定合适的边界条件是至关重要的步骤。这一过程不仅关系到模拟的准确性,也直接影响到计算效率和结果的可靠性。首先,你需要熟悉软件界面,了解网格生成的各种工具和选项,这可以通过《STAR-CCM+初学者中文教程:网格生成与流体力学基础》来实现。该教程提供了从基础到高级网格技术的详细指导,使初学者能够快速掌握必要的技能。
参考资源链接:[STAR-CCM+初学者中文教程:网格生成与流体力学基础](https://wenku.csdn.net/doc/72tbe1h9mw?spm=1055.2569.3001.10343)
为了生成高质量的CFD网格,你应当遵循以下步骤:
1. 定义计算域:确定你希望模拟的区域,并创建一个适合的几何模型。几何模型需要足够详细,以捕捉到流动的重要特征,但同时也要避免不必要的复杂性,以减少计算资源的消耗。
2. 网格类型选择:根据问题的性质选择合适的网格类型。STAR-CCM+提供了多种网格技术,如四面体、六面体、多面体等。对于复杂几何形状,多面体网格通常可以提供更高的网格质量和更好的计算性能。
3. 网格尺寸和控制:控制网格的尺寸和渐变对于捕捉到流场中的重要细节至关重要。在关键区域(如边界层附近)应用细化的网格,而在流场变化不大的区域应用较为粗略的网格。
4. 网格质量检查:完成网格生成后,需要检查网格质量指标,如长宽比、雅克比、扭曲率等。STAR-CCM+提供了自动化的质量检查工具,确保网格满足模拟要求。
接下来,正确设定边界条件:
1. 定义流体属性:输入或选择适当的流体材料属性,如密度、粘度等。
2. 应用边界条件:为计算域的边界设置适当的边界条件。例如,对于入口边界,设置速度入口或质量流率入口;对于出口边界,可能设置压力出口或自由出流条件;对于固体壁面,应用无滑移条件或适当的壁面函数。
3. 湍流模型选择:根据流动特征选择合适的湍流模型。STAR-CCM+支持多种模型,从简单的零方程模型到复杂的LES或大涡模拟模型。
4. 初始条件:设定初始场的条件,如速度场、压力场等。这些初始条件应尽可能接近预期的稳定状态。
5. 模拟控制:设置求解器参数,如时间步长、迭代次数、收敛标准等。
在整个过程中,你可以利用STAR-CCM+的后处理工具来监测和验证模拟结果,确保模拟的可靠性。如果你是STAR-CCM+的新手,建议从《STAR-CCM+初学者中文教程:网格生成与流体力学基础》提供的实例开始实践,这些实例将帮助你理解上述步骤,并且在实际操作中应用它们。
参考资源链接:[STAR-CCM+初学者中文教程:网格生成与流体力学基础](https://wenku.csdn.net/doc/72tbe1h9mw?spm=1055.2569.3001.10343)
阅读全文